The Jazz organization has requested a pre-Christmas trip ever since the first one back in the 1985-86 season.
Being less distracted does not guarantee victories, though. Even without yuletide parties and events to attend, Utah has only gone 61-63 in the trips, and only two Jazz teams have gone unbeaten. They went 6-0 in 1994-95 and won all three games in the final Stockton-to-Malone season in 2002-03.
But winning and missing out on egg nog and white elephant gifts aren't the only things on Jazz players' minds this trip.
They also hope not to get frostbite after they leave Louisiana.
Predicted high temperatures in Milwaukee, Cleveland and Minneapolis range between 15-24 degrees.
Guard Raja Bell, who lives in Miami in the offseason, repeated "brutal" four times while thinking of the wintry weather ahead.
"I like to wear certain clothes and I like my fashion," Bell said. "But for this one, I just threw a bunch of big sweaters and a coat in there."
Williams also said his luggage is packed with warm sweaters.
"We should be used to it," he said. "It's been a little chilly here."
And the father of three is not too bothered about being away from home for a week before Christmas. His wife is taking their three kids on their own holiday trip.
"As long as we're there for Santa to come," he added with a smile, "they don't care."
Somewhere up north St. Nick is laying a finger aside of his nose and nodding.
